276°
Posted 20 hours ago

AZDelivery D1 Mini NodeMcu WiFi Board ESP8266-12F CH340G WLAN ESP8266 Micro USB Lua Module 3.3V 500mA compatible with Arduino Including E-Book!

£9.9£99Clearance
ZTS2023's avatar
Shared by
ZTS2023
Joined in 2023
82
63

About this deal

The WeMos D1 min PRO is a miniature wireless 802.11 (Wifi) microcontroller development board. It turns the very popular ESP8266 wireless microcontroller module into a fully fledged development board. Programming the D1 mini pro is as simple as programming any other Arduino based microcontroller as the module includes a built in microUSB interface allowing the module to be programmed directly from the Arduino IDE (requires the ESP8266 support to be added via board manager) with no additional hardware. There are certain pins that output a 3.3V signal when the ESP8266 boots. This may be problematic if you have relays or other peripherals connected to those GPIOs. The following GPIOs output a HIGH signal on boot: Just connect an USB cable to your board - that's all (since the units have onboard UART controllers).

DS18B20 temperature sensor – this is a really accurate sensor which allows the chaining of multiple sensors on a single data wire. Serial.printf("Set json... %s\n", Firebase.RTDB.setJSON(&fbdo, parentPath.c_str(), &json) ? "ok" : fbdo.errorReason().c_str()); Next, go to “Tools>Board>Board Manager” in your Arduino IDE, select “esp8266 by ESP8266 community” from the dropdown list of available boards, and continue the installation process. One important thing to notice about ESP8266 is that the GPIO number doesn’t match the label on the board silkscreen. For example, D0 corresponds to GPIO16 and D1 corresponds to GPIO5.It is possible that a single ADC channel may not be enough for some projects, but this is a limitation of any board based upon the ESP8266. Connect the micro USB cable to the D1 Mini or NodeMCU and on your iPhone, iPad, or MacBook, open the Home app. Then follow these steps to add the HomeKit-enabled DIY weather station as an accessory to the Home app. The weather station we made will be recognized and added as an unofficial accessory. However, it will work similarly to an official Elgato Eve Degree sensor for Apple HomeKit. When the 5V pin is coupled to a 5V supply, the Wemos D1 Mini will be powered from an external 5V supply.

There boards offer enough IO pins to do a variety of different projects, however it is also possible to expand this if needed.

Step 2. Download the Arduino IDE

The ESP8266 requires 3.3V to operate, therefore all iterations of the Wemos D1 Mini and other boards using the ESP8266 chip must have 3.3V onboard to function. Additionally, the other GPIOs, except GPIO5 and GPIO4, can output a low-voltage signal at boot, which can be problematic if these are connected to transistors or relays. You can read this article that investigates the state and behavior of each GPIO on boot. First we need to connect the DS18B20 to the Wemos D1 Mini (or whichever board you are using) which is simple, it requires just 3 connections – 3.3v/5v, Ground and Data. We will use a program that flashes the on-board LED to test if the board works,. This is the same blink program included in the IDE so you might as well go to File > Examples > 01. Basics > Blink. void setup() { The technical specification of the Wemos D1 Mini is really defined by the specification of the ESP8266 chip.

Asda Great Deal

Free UK shipping. 15 day free returns.
Community Updates
*So you can easily identify outgoing links on our site, we've marked them with an "*" symbol. Links on our site are monetised, but this never affects which deals get posted. Find more info in our FAQs and About Us page.
New Comment